The Effect of Refractory Mill Additions on the Thermal Expansion of Enamel

Crazing,spalling,warp,and other problems are caused by stress that develops between enamel and steel substrate during the cooling cycle of the firing process.This effect is due to the differences in coefficients of thermal expansion (CTEs) of the two materials.Above the glass transition temperature (T_g),in the process of cooling,the stress is relieved first by the viscous flow and,at the lower temperatures,by the plastic deformation of the enamel.
